Labor Liberation Workshop

The Labor Liberation Workshop is a multi-media popular education program of Colorado Jobs with Justice. In this workshop we explore the history and roots of worker struggle, the complexities of the labor movement and the intersections of diverse identities, and what building a community vision of worker power might look like with a lens of racial and economic justice. The workshop is intended to build a grassroots movement for labor justice, support inter-sectional organizations and groups in Denver and animate people to participate in direct action for worker rights.
The goal of the workshop is for participants to come away with increased awareness and
 pride about their place within the labor movement as well as new insights regarding how to build an inclusive and powerful movement. Additionally, the workshop employs anti-oppression analysis to facilitate exploration of the concepts of power, privilege, structural and institutional oppression and how they relate to the labor movement.
